# IS215AEPCH1A Technical Specifications and Applications

## Introduction to IS215AEPCH1A

The IS215AEPCH1A is a specialized industrial control module designed for use in complex automation systems. Manufactured by General Electric (GE), this component plays a critical role in distributed control systems (DCS) and other industrial applications where reliable performance is essential.

## Key Technical Specifications

### Physical Characteristics

– Dimensions: 6.5 x 5.25 x 1.5 inches (approximate)
– Weight: Approximately 1.2 lbs
– Material: Industrial-grade metal casing
– Color: Standard industrial gray

### Electrical Specifications

– Input Voltage: 24V DC (nominal)
– Power Consumption: 15W (maximum)
– Operating Temperature: -40°C to +70°C
– Storage Temperature: -50°C to +85°C
– Humidity Range: 5% to 95% non-condensing

### Communication Features

– Ethernet Ports: 2 x 10/100 Mbps
– Protocol Support: Modbus TCP/IP, IEC 61850
– Serial Communication: RS-232/RS-485 options

## Functional Capabilities

The IS215AEPCH1A module provides several critical functions in industrial environments:

– Real-time data acquisition and processing
– Advanced alarm management
– Secure communication with other system components
– Redundant operation capabilities
– Firmware upgrade support

## Typical Applications

### Power Generation Systems

This module is commonly deployed in:

– Gas turbine control systems
– Steam turbine monitoring
– Generator protection systems
– Plant-wide distributed control

### Industrial Automation

Other applications include:

– Oil and gas processing facilities
– Chemical plant automation
– Water treatment systems
– Manufacturing process control

## Installation and Maintenance

### Mounting Requirements

The IS215AEPCH1A is designed for DIN rail mounting in standard industrial control cabinets. Proper spacing (minimum 1 inch clearance on all sides) is recommended for optimal heat dissipation.

### Maintenance Considerations

– Regular firmware updates recommended
– Periodic inspection of connections
– Environmental monitoring for temperature and humidity
– Backup of configuration settings

## Compatibility Information

The IS215AEPCH1A is compatible with:

– GE Mark VIe control systems
– Various HMI interfaces
– Third-party SCADA systems (with appropriate drivers)
– Legacy GE control equipment (with adapters)
